Below we show the results of the previous slide converted into default times, assuming a flat CDS spread of<br />

120 bps and 40% recovery rate<br />

The below charts illustrate the dependency pattern in the default times each of the four copulas generates<br />

While the upper tail dependence of the Gumbel copula results in a clustering of early defaults, it is the other<br />

way round for the Clayton copula<br />

As expected, the transformation from survivor rates to default times affects the linear correlation, especially<br />

in case of the Gumbel and Clayton copula<br />

Kendall’s Tau however remains unchanged as the ranking structure is not altered via this transformation<br />
